The United States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) uses selective whole genome amplification (sWGA) to preferentially amplify Plasmodium falciparum DNA isolated from human blood. This step increases the ratio of P. falciparum to human DNA in a given eluate and thus increases the yield of P. falciparum derived reads from next-generation sequencing (NGS). CDC uses a NextSeq1000 instrument for NGS after sWGA for P. falciparum. This approach facilitates a wide-range of analyses, including, but not limited to: drug-resistance surveillance, identification of closely related / identical P. falciparum genomes for outbreak tracing, and identifying the most-likely geographic origin for the source of the infection. CDC has removed all human-derived reads from data uploaded to this BioProject.
